> First set of fixes for 4.14
>
> * A couple of bugzilla bugs related to multicast handling;
> * Two fixes for WoWLAN bugs that were causing queue hangs and
>   re-initialization problems;
> * Two fixes for potential uninitialized variable use reported by Dan
>   Carpenter in relation to a recently introduced patch;
> * A fix for buffer reordering in the newly supported 9000 device
>   family;
> * Fix a race when starting aggregation;
> * Small fix for a recent patch to wake mac80211 queues;
> * Send non-bufferable management frames in the generic queue so they
>   are not sent on queues that are under power-save;
